I did biochemistry undergrad and chemistry for my Ph.D. The other answers are correct and you should ultimately choose what you prefer more. If your end goal is research and you are unsure of the differences and given I’ve done research in both, I’ll give you some generalizations.

Biochemistry (not including molecular biology) - Does very little study into actual chemistry. They care more about the structure and activity of different biological macromolecules, be it proteins, RNA, DNA, etc.

Chemistry - Research is usually far more specific (with exceptions of course) of fabricating specific molecular targets for specific functions or applications.
